You can use a modern Mac to send files to an older Mac, but you first have to tell AirDrop to search for the older Mac. Older Macs use a legacy implementation of AirDrop that isn’t compatible with the latest iOS devices. It will be a while before the majority of people have such a chip in their device, though. The U1 is designed to improve device discoverability and eliminate the issues that have plagued AirDrop for years. This is one of the reasons Apple introduced the new U1 chip with ultra-wideband technology for the iPhone 11.
